Bowen is a very gentle, yet effective, complimentary therapy. It works over the soft tissue, treating the whole body without reference to a named disease or condition.
This alternative therapy is very useful for remedial work, as well as offering a health maintenance service to fine-tune the body and to allow the horse to work to its full potential. The best cure is prevention, treating minor problems before they become major injuries. Bowen is also useful to promote recovery after surgery, help the horse to overcome emotional issues and assist the body in the release of stiffness or tension.
Bowen works with the body to enhance the natural healing processes and help the body to rebalance itself.
